Goldeneyes

Common Goldeneyes are among the diving ducks that migrate to the San Francisco Bay Area for the winter. The birds are a beautiful sight with their striking color contrasts and vivid golden eyes.

A similar but less common species in the Bay Area, the Barrow's Goldeneye is distinguished (in male plumage) by a crescent shaped white spot on its cheek, as opposed to the rounder marking of the Common Goldeneye.
